Section 37.2602a – Repealed. 1992, Act 258, Eff. Dec. 8, 1994.
37.2602a Repealed. 1992, Act 258, Eff. Dec. 8, 1994. Compiler’s Notes: The repealed section pertained to business conducted with the state or an agency, requests for review of equal employment opportunity practices, and creation of civil rights contract monitoring fund.

Section 37.2702 – Violation of Order Prohibited.
37.2702 Violation of order prohibited. Sec. 702. A person shall not violate the terms of an order or an adjustment order made under this act. History: 1976, Act 453, Eff. Mar. 31, 1977
Section 37.2703 – Revocation or Suspension of License.
37.2703 Revocation or suspension of license. Sec. 703. If a certification is made pursuant to section 605(3), the licensing agency may take appropriate action to revoke or suspend the license of the respondent. History: 1976, Act 453, Eff. Mar. 31, 1977
